Deadline For Civic Awards

Communities across Ross-shire have just one more week to get their entries in for the 2005 Ross and Cromarty Civic and Community Awards.

These annual awards, organised by The Highland Council’s Ross and Cromarty Committee, recognise the work of people from all age groups and walks of life who have contributed to the success and wellbeing of their local community.

There are a number of awards and categories include a Good Neighbour award, an award for the best community project, as well as awards for business, sporting and musical achievement. The award ceremony, which will be held on the 28th November at Ross County Football Club, culminates in the presentation of the Citizen of the Year Award.

Area Convener, Councillor Carolyn Wilson said: "There is still time to put forward the name of someone who you feel deserves recognition for the work they do and the contribution to the lives of others that they make. Often such people work quietly behind the scenes without a fuss. These Civic Awards are the ideal opportunity for their efforts to be officially recognised and for us to show our appreciation."
